Took a step in the war against traction!!

Anyone who has an M6 SS, and has been to the dragstrip, knows how difficult it is to consistently execute a good launch with the 20 inch wheels and runflats. My best 60 ft time has been 2.08 so far. I started to buy a set of headers and an intake manifold, but thought whats the point if i cant put the power down? So instead I decided to order a set of rear drag wheels. Went with the Weld RT-S 17x10 made specifically for our cars and some Mickey Thompson ET Street R's in the 305/45R17 size. Everything came in today and only took a week to get. Going to get them mounted tomm and hopefully test them out at the track if it doesn't rain this weekend.
